Canadian designer Arielle de Pinto graduated from Montreal's Concordia University in 2007 with a degree in Fine Arts. Her studies with print and textiles, in addition to a series of professional internships, led de Pinto to develop her own line of jewelry, which launched later that same year. Her eponymous label is characterized by the unique treatment of metal as a supple fiber, giving her hand-crocheted pieces considerable mass while appearing visually delicate.
